About HCVT

HCVT is a CPA firm that provides tax, audit, accounting, and business advisory services to privately held businesses and high net worth individuals. The firm was founded in 1991 and has grown to become one of the largest CPA firms in Southern California. HCVT has a team of over 700 professionals and serves clients in a variety of industries, including real estate, healthcare, technology, and entertainment. The firm is committed to providing exceptional client service and has a reputation for delivering innovative solutions to complex business challenges.
